引言
ARP(Address Resolution Protocol)断网攻击是一种常见的网络攻击手段,它通过篡改局域网内设备的ARP表,使得数据包无法正常到达目的地,从而达到断网的目的。本文将深入探讨ARP断网攻击的原理、危害以及应对策略。
ARP断网攻击原理
1. ARP协议简介
ARP协议是一种用于将IP地址转换为MAC地址的协议。在网络中,每台设备都有一个唯一的MAC地址,而IP地址则是用于标识网络中的设备。ARP协议的作用就是通过IP地址找到对应的MAC地址。
2. ARP攻击原理
ARP攻击者通过伪造ARP响应包,将自己的MAC地址与目标设备的IP地址关联起来,使得局域网内的其他设备将数据包发送到攻击者的MAC地址。这样,攻击者就可以截获、篡改或丢弃数据包,从而实现断网攻击。
3. 攻击过程
- 攻击者发送伪造的ARP响应包,将自己的MAC地址与目标设备的IP地址关联起来。
- 目标设备的ARP表被篡改,将数据包发送到攻击者的MAC地址。
- 攻击者截获、篡改或丢弃数据包,导致目标设备无法正常通信。
ARP断网攻击的危害
1. 严重影响网络通信
ARP断网攻击会导致局域网内设备无法正常通信,从而影响工作效率和用户体验。
2. 信息泄露
攻击者可以截获、篡改数据包,从而获取敏感信息,如用户名、密码等。
3. 网络设备损坏
长时间的ARP攻击可能导致网络设备过载,从而损坏设备。
应对策略
1. 使用静态ARP表
将网络设备的IP地址和MAC地址绑定,防止ARP攻击。
# Python代码示例:设置静态ARP表
import subprocess
def set_static_arp(ip, mac):
command = f"arp -s {ip} {mac}"
subprocess.run(command, shell=True)
# 设置静态ARP表
set_static_arp("192.168.1.1", "00:1A:2B:3C:4D:5E")
2. 开启防火墙功能
开启防火墙,禁止不安全的ARP请求。
3. 使用ARP检测工具
使用ARP检测工具实时监控网络,发现ARP攻击并及时处理。
4. 更新操作系统和软件
定期更新操作系统和软件,修复已知的安全漏洞。
5. 提高安全意识
加强网络安全意识,避免点击不明链接和下载不明软件。
总结
ARP断网攻击是一种常见的网络攻击手段,了解其原理和应对策略对于保障网络安全至关重要。通过使用静态ARP表、开启防火墙、使用ARP检测工具等手段,可以有效预防和应对ARP断网攻击。